How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Beaverton?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Cheap Beaverton Studio Apartments | $1,554 | $617 | $2,561 |
| Cheap Beaverton 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,738 | $995 | $4,698 |
| Cheap Beaverton 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,936 | $1,240 | $5,763 |
| Cheap Beaverton 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,440 | $1,544 | $5,313 |
| Cheap Beaverton 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,241 | $2,070 | $3,950 |
